Developing Fine Motor Skills
Coloring, in itself, is an essential activity for children’s cognitive development. As they navigate the intricate lines and shapes within a unicorn coloring page, children hone their fine motor skills, hand-eye coordination, and dexterity. The precise movements required to color within designated areas help strengthen their fingers, wrists, and arms, laying the foundation for future writing and drawing skills. By encouraging children to experiment with various coloring tools, such as crayons, markers, or colored pencils, adults can further enhance their fine motor abilities.
Exploring Color Theory
Unicorn coloring pages offer a unique opportunity for children to explore the world of colors. As they bring these mythical creatures to life with vibrant hues, children learn about primary and secondary colors, tints, and shades. By mixing and matching different colors, they develop an understanding of color theory and the relationships between various hues. This foundational knowledge can be applied to future art projects, design, and even science, where color plays a crucial role.

Integrating Math and Science Concepts
Unicorn coloring pages can also be used to introduce basic math and science concepts. Children can practice counting, addition, and subtraction by coloring a specific number of unicorns or counting the number of colors used. The fantastical elements of unicorns, such as their magical powers or habitats, can lead to discussions about scientific concepts like energy, ecosystems, and biology. By incorporating math and science into the coloring process, adults can create a fun and interactive learning experience.
